Company Overview

Established small business in Bellflower, CA with 25 years of experience in buying/selling used computers and IT equipment, secure data destruction, and responsible electronics recycling. Services support organizations seeking compliant, efficient IT asset disposition and reuse solutions.

Position Summary

This internship supports lead generation and digital marketing efforts by helping identify target organizations, reach decision-makers, strengthen digital content, and improve marketing workflows. The role combines research, outreach, content creation, and basic performance tracking.

Key Responsibilities

  • Lead research & list building: Identify target organizations (e.g., schools, businesses, agencies, healthcare), locate relevant contacts (IT, procurement, operations), and maintain accurate lead lists/CRM records.
  • Outreach & follow-up: Draft and send professional outreach emails, manage follow-up cadence, and document outcomes to support consistent pipeline development.
  • Email marketing support: Assist with creating and organizing templates and short sequences, maintaining contact segments, and tracking metrics such as opens, replies, and meetings scheduled.
  • Digital content creation: Develop concise content for LinkedIn and other channels, including short posts and simple graphics aligned with core services and value propositions.
  • Website & marketing asset updates: Support updates to service descriptions, FAQs, and one-pagers to ensure messaging is clear, current, and consistent across channels.
  • Reporting & process organization: Produce a basic weekly activity report (leads added, outreach volume, responses, content output) and help document repeatable marketing processes.
